Introduction to gui to create a graphical interface gui in python you need to make use of a library or module. Python can be used to perform complex mathematical calculations, handle big data, build web apps and desktop applications, and manage databases. I guess this isnt so necessary in python due to dynamic typing and duck. You can make windows, buttons, show text and images amongst other things. Tkinter provides a powerful objectoriented interface to the tk gui toolkit. A comprehensive introduction to python programming and. Its crossplatform, so the same code works on windows, macos, and linux. Its syntax resembles pseudocode, especially because of the fact that indentation is used to indentify blocks. Python is a dynamcally typed language, and does not require variables to be declared before they are used.
Neste episodio vamos aprender a criar uma interface grafica, utilizando a biblioteca framework kivy. Pythonand tkinter programming graphical user interfaces for python programs. Aplicaciones graficas con tkinter en python parte 1 mi. Python is a great language for beginners, but when you want to give your application a graphical interface, youll need to learn to use a gui framework. Tkinter is a python interface to the tk graphics library.
Python has a lot of gui frameworks, but tkinter is the only framework thats built into the python standard library. Quickly learn the right way to build attractive and modern graphical user interfaces with python and tkinter. Pdf manual interaz grafica en python tkinter mario. Tkinter commonly comes bundled with python, using tk and is python s standard gui framework. An introduction to graphical user interface with python s tkinter by. Getting started with tkinter remarks tkinter tk interface is pythons standard crossplatform package for creating graphical user interfaces guis. A especificacao da linguagem e mantida pela python software foundation2 psf. It provides a robust and platform independent windowing toolkit, that is available to python programmers using the tkinter package, and its extension, the tkinter. Provides a simple python 3 interface to the apache pdfbox commandline tools. There are at least three widely used modules for creating guis with python. It is opensource and available under the python license. Tkinter is a graphical user interface gui module for python, you can make desktop apps with python. They enforce the condition that the instantiated class that implements the interface, will have a memory footprint or signature that will allow the interpretercompiler to know with certainty the size of the object. Tkinter guis in python dan fleck cs112 george mason university coming up.
Visual elements are rendered using native operating system elements, so applications built with tkinter look like they belong on the platform where. It provides access to an underlying tcl interpreter with the tk toolkit, which itself is a crossplatform, multilanguage graphical user interface library. This course is the fourth of a series on python programming. A program means very little if it does not take input of some kind from the program user. Requirements aside from python 3 and those packages specified in setup. Tk and tkinter apps can run on most unix platforms. This course is the third of a series on python programming. Python tkinter introduccion interface grafica pere manel. It is known to work with cpython3 and pycopy unix version is officially supported for the latter, but should work with any python3 implementation which allows to access stdinstdout file descriptors. Tkinter comes preinstalled with python3, and you need not bother about installing it. Likewise, if there is no form of output from a program then one may ask why we have a. This course presents techniques to build graphical user interfaces gui in python.
Algo muy buscado en python son las guias sobre interfaces graficas ya sea. Abstract this application note dives into the use of a gui using tkinter and python. An introduction to graphical user interface with python s. The module tkinter is an interface to the tk gui toolkit. You want to create a user interface for your application. It is famous for its simplicity and graphical user interface. Picotui is a text user interface tui widget library for python3. Tk is a graphics library widely used and available everywhere. Ambos podem ser usados tanto em linux codeblocks e graphapp como em windows. Objetivo foto alterada com o filtro cubism do gimp.
Tutorial introduction to gui with tkinter in python. Python, when combined with tkinter, provides a fast and easy way to create gui applications. The tkinter package is a thin objectoriented layer on top of tcltk. You dont want to waste time messing around with things you dont need. The use of a gui is very important to user and computer system interaction, and.
580 811 737 766 1068 1369 576 38 1498 614 1165 192 682 1569 1017 1098 1562 1347 725 1599 97 1330 1170 1283 1541 1033 1178 951 471 676 1479 1256 1619 1053 1245 900 804 919 198 555 1135